I tested the sample import code listed under the Direct method heading in Quicken for Mac Deluxe 2018 (version 5.6.3) and it imported the transaction but interpreted the year as the year 007. I then modified line six from the current 'D12/21' 7' and changed it to include a full four-digit year, i.e. 'D' and it imported perfectly.

One question on the setting though: Is the Chinese Civil War ever mentioned later on and does it have any bearing on the story? For a country having been rife with political turmoil and battered by the Sino-Japanese War its position in Japan seems a little too strong.
It's hard to imagine that the war wouldn't happen even with the alternate timeline, since the timing of the Great Disaster should have still et the war damage the Nationalists and benefit the Communists enough for them to engage in a major protracted conflict. Not to mention the heavily deteriorating state of the economy. I somehow doubt the Chinese would have enough strength at the time to even consider taking control over large parts of Japan. (blegh can't get the spoiler formatting for the second part to work correctly so I'll just post it without) But the most major problem with the occupation of Japan comes when you bring in the 'who' into the 'when'. If Nationalist forces occupied Japan before the Civil War became full blown it would end up in a situation similar to Taiwan, where they would just allow the GMD to remain there due to not having the naval forces needed to pursue them (the later issue of US protection of Taiwan would be far more significant for Japan too, since there is actually American territory there).
If the Communist forces tried to occupy Japan after the civil war (i.e. Nationalists did not occupy prior), it would already be far after the Americans had taken control.
A jointly Nationalist and US occupied Japan could create something similar to the spheres of influence in Japan but there would be significantly more cooperation rather than political competition. This happens because the options you chose put you into a route that you have not unlocked. I would recommend using a and using the skip feature to choose a specific girls route. Feel free to not use a walkthrough, but at least know that only Kotori, Chihaya, and Lucia's routes are available until you complete at least one on them. Kotori's route is highly recommended as it serves as a great introduction to the post-common route part of the game, but it would be fine to choose another route if you really want to.
